Color Option Tips
Choosing the right color for a suit is necessary, as it can dramatically affect your general look and the perception you leave on others. When selecting a fit shade, take into consideration the message and the event you desire to communicate. For formal occasions, classic colors such as navy, charcoal gray, and black are optimal, as they radiate professionalism and class.
Alternatively, for less official settings, such as informal fridays or social gatherings, lighter tones like beige, light gray, or pastel colors can include a revitalizing touch while still preserving a polished look. It's additionally important to think of your complexion; warmer skin tones commonly match earth tones and warmer shades, while cooler skin tones tend to balance with blues and Our site gem tones.
In addition, consider the season when choosing fit shades. Darker hues are typically favored in fall and wintertime, while lighter shades are preferable for spring and summertime. Don't hesitate to integrate refined patterns or structures to add depth to your outfit, but ensure they remain appropriate for the occasion. By very carefully choosing your fit color, you can improve your individual design and leave a long-term impression.
Fit and Customizing Essentials
Achieving the ideal fit is critical to showcasing a fit's elegance and improving the user's confidence. A well-fitted suit other must contour the body without restricting movement, striking the equilibrium in between comfort and design. To ensure an ideal fit, focus should be paid to several crucial locations: shoulders, breast, waist, and sleeves.
The shoulders need to line up completely with the user's all-natural shoulder line, preventing any type of sagging or tightness. The chest needs to permit a mild void when buttoned, making sure comfort while keeping a customized appearance. The waist of the jacket need to taper a little to produce a flattering shape, while the trousers need to fit easily around the waist without the requirement for a belt to hold them up.
Sleeve length is additionally vital; ideally, the coat sleeves must end simply above the wrist, permitting a glimpse of the tee shirt cuff. Ultimately, the trouser length must strike the appropriate balance-- either resting delicately on the shoes for a clean appearance or damaging slightly for a much more loosened up style.
Spending in tailoring can transform an off-the-rack fit right into a bespoke masterpiece, making it important for any critical gentleman.
